FITTING FOREMAN

FITTING FOREMAN

Department/Division: Mechanical / Piping

Reports To: Fitting Supervisor

Job Summary

The Fitting Foreman leads a crew of fitters, ensuring daily fabrication targets are met with precision and safety.

Key Responsibilities

  • Assign daily tasks to fitters.

  • Verify measurements and cut lengths of pipes and steel.

  • Inspect joint preparation (bevel angles) and fit-up alignment.

  • Ensure correct orientation of valves and fittings as per drawings.

  • Supervise rigging and lifting of spools into position.

  • Maintain tool inventory for the crew.

  • Enforce PPE compliance.

Required Qualifications

  • Trade Test I, II, III in Pipe Fitting/Fabrication.

  • NABTEB Technical Certificate.

Experience Requirements

  • Minimum 7 years experience with 2 years leading a team.

Technical Skills & Competencies

  • Strong ability to read ISO drawings.

  • Proficient in using cutting torches and grinders.

Key Performance Indicators (KPIs)

  • Daily fit-up production counts.

  • Compliance with fit-up tolerances.

Working Conditions

  • Site based, outdoor environment.

Physical Requirements

  • Physically demanding role involving lifting and positioning materials.
